**Night Shift — Recording Studio (Room 4B)**

The Fennick Media training studio runs unattended overnight. Check the booking sheet before entering. Power down lights and teleprompter after any maintenance. Do not move camera rigs; they are marked on the floor. Report faults in the night log, not by phone. Lock the equipment cage before leaving. The studio door uses a keypad; enter with the code below.

badge for fahap-kahof: bdg-EQUNTN-00774017

Handover note — reception, Varnell House

Teo, as discussed: the mail room moves from the ground floor to Level 2 East this Friday. Couriers should be directed to the Level 2 service lift from Monday onward; the old room will be locked and signage removed. Sorting trays and the franking machine go over Thursday evening, so expect a gap in outgoing post that afternoon. The new room door runs on the keypad, not badges, so use the code below.

staff pass of kawip-hawef = bdg-QLP-2

Runbook: Nightfill, the nightly backfill scheduler for the Corvid warehouse. It wakes up after the upstream export lands, figures out which date ranges are stale, and fans out backfill jobs in batches. If a batch dies, don't just rerun it — check whether the export was partial first, or you'll happily backfill garbage. Pausing the scheduler is safe; it resumes from its checkpoint table. Most tuning happens in one place, and the current production configuration is shown here.

settings of fafog-haduf:
ZORIX_PIN=4648
ZORIX_METRICS_HOST=metrics.zorix.paliqsys.corp
ZORIX_LOG_LEVEL=info
ZORIX_TENANT=druix